Power transmission plays a defining role in the energy security of a region but because the industry is more operationally intensive it rarely makes headlines, often working silently in the background to ensure critical services are kept running at all times. Fluctuations in demand directly affects the rotation of generators leading to more or less watts on the line as required. Power systems engineering controls that. Behind the scenes there is a complex system of tools from transformers and switchgears to HVDC converters and actual power lines to make this transmission happen. These tools require highly standardized conductors and insulators to operate and their manufacturing is specialised.
